Summary
The Generator Mechanic is responsible for inspecting, diagnosing, maintaining, and repairing generators to ensure safe, reliable, and efficient operation. This position performs preventive maintenance, troubleshooting, installation support, and customer guidance while following established safety standards and technical procedures.
Responsibilities
Accurately inspect and diagnose mechanical and electrical issues with generators.
Perform routine and preventive maintenance to minimize generator downtime.
Repair malfunctioning generators and replace defective components as necessary.
Oversee and assist with installation of new generators, ensuring they are fully operational.
Test generator output and performance to confirm compliance with specifications and operational requirements.
Maintain detailed documentation of all maintenance, repairs, inspections, and service actions.
Adhere to safety protocols and procedures while servicing equipment.
Communicate with customers to identify generator needs and recommend appropriate solutions.
Provide guidance and education on generator operation and safety practices.
Remain current on technological advancements and implement updated techniques when applicable.
Order, track, and replace parts, materials, and supplies.
Support process improvements related to maintenance procedures and service operations.
Contribute to reporting, recordkeeping, and the development of technical documentation.
Perform other duties as assigned.
Qualifications
Thorough understanding of diesel and gasoline engines, electrical systems, and generator components.
Strong electrical and mechanical troubleshooting skills, including the ability to read technical drawings and schematics.
Completion of a technical program in electrical or mechanical engineering, or equivalent professional experience.
Proven ability to diagnose and repair mechanical and electrical malfunctions.
Excellent communication, customer service, and documentation skills.
Ability to consistently follow and enforce safety protocols.
Minimum Qualifications
Minimum of 5 years of experience working with civilian and/or military‑style generators.
At least 2 years of unsupervised field experience performing comprehensive generator maintenance.
Preferred Qualifications
Technician certification from FG Willison, Cummins, Caterpillar, or similar organizations, preferred.
Prior military or LOGCAP generator maintenance experience.
